I have an 2006 Grand Prix, I no longer get heat in the car. I have replaced the drivers side actuator motor. The lines to the heater core are hot on both lines. What else should or could I look at?

Is your blower motor working? Is air coming out of the vents?
yes the blower motor is working, I can get cold air to blow out of all the vents.
I replaced the drivers side and still only have cold. i do have dual climate control, is the passenger side just as important?
replaced both blend door actuators and still cant get any heat.What elseshould I look at?
by chance when you had the actuator off, did you try to turn the knob it sits on, turn it one way is cold, the other is hot. if its sticky or wont move, the actuator wont turn it.
you can also take the glove box off, and change the temp while holding your finger on the part that moves to see if its moving at all if you dont want to just take it off.
if you do take it off, leave it plugged in, then work the temp up and then down, see if it moves. if it dont move you may have a blown fuse or bad climate control.
whats the outside temp reading, is it accurate? or way off, the temp sensor can also throw off your heat.
